Managed to get some not so blurry (but still crappy and dark) pictures of my black leopard. I've had the fish for about 3 weeks. Never thought I would like a fish better than my B&W clowns but this one is growing on me!

You can see it is a pretty thick fish. It has a pretty voracious appetite and eats twice a day. Only frozen hykari, spirulina brine and PE mysis. Chases flakes but still pulls back.

Thanks guys. Yes, still running T5s. 4 bulbs (ATI Blue+ x 2, ATI Aquablue Special and a UVL Superactinic). Just ordered 2 new bulbs to try out. Ordered a Geisemann Lagoon Blue and an ATI Coral+. I do have a 12x3 watt LED strip on this tank with all Cree XT-E Royal Blues but the LEDs are off in those pics.
